CIC updated processing timings.
all the applications received on or after April 1st 2015 - it is 12 months.
applications received before march 31st 2015 - their application will be completed by Mar 2016 or 24 months whichever comes first.

it is a good hope for all of us.

they also updated that online status will be updated every Tuesday for citizenship.
